您的位置:首页 > 新闻资讯

SQL Server实例名查看方法,你掌握了吗?

2025-07-02 09:35:02

SQL Server实例名怎么查看,是许多数据库管理员和开发人员经常遇到的问题。实例名是在安装SQL Server时确定的,用于区分在同一台计算机上运行的不同SQL Server实例。了解如何查看SQL Server实例名,对于数据库的连接和管理至关重要。本文将详细介绍几种常见的方法来查看SQL Server实例名,帮助大家轻松解决这一问题。

SQL Server实例名查看方法,你掌握了吗? 1

方法一:使用SQL Server Configuration Manager

SQL Server Configuration Manager是一个强大的工具,可用于配置SQL Server实例和组件。通过这个工具,你可以轻松查看当前计算机上安装的所有SQL Server实例名称。

SQL Server实例名查看方法,你掌握了吗? 2

1. 打开SQL Server Configuration Manager:你可以在Windows开始菜单中搜索“SQL Server Configuration Manager”来找到并打开它。

2. 找到SQL Server服务:在左侧的导航栏中,展开“SQL Server服务”节点。

3. 查看实例名称:在右侧的窗口中,你将看到一个SQL Server服务列表。每个服务的名称即对应一个SQL Server实例的名称。默认情况下,默认实例通常显示为“MSSQLSERVER”,而命名实例则会显示为其在安装时指定的名称。

这种方法直观且易于操作,是查看SQL Server实例名的首选方法之一。

方法二:通过Windows注册表

如果你无法正常启动SQL Server,或者希望通过更底层的方式来获取实例名称,可以直接查阅Windows注册表中的相关信息。但请注意,直接操作注册表有一定的风险,如果不熟悉注册表结构,可能会导致系统问题,因此请谨慎操作。

1. 打开注册表编辑器:按下Win + R组合键,输入“regedit”并按下回车键,启动注册表编辑器。

2. 定位到SQL Server实例名称路径:在注册表编辑器中,导航到以下路径:`H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\Instance Names\SQL`。

3. 查看实例名称:在右侧窗格中,你将看到一系列键值对。这些键代表了已安装的不同版本的SQL Server实例及其对应的具体命名。

通过注册表查看实例名虽然稍显复杂,但在某些特定情况下非常有用。

方法三:使用T-SQL查询语句

如果你已经连接到了某个特定的SQL Server数据库引擎,那么可以通过执行简单的Transact-SQL命令来返回所在服务器/实例的名称。

1. 连接到SQL Server:使用SQL Server Management Studio(SSMS)或其他SQL客户端工具连接到你的SQL Server实例。

2. 执行T-SQL查询:在查询窗口中,输入以下T-SQL语句并执行:

```sql

SELECT @@SERVERNAME AS 'Server Name', SERVERPROPERTY('InstanceName') AS 'Instance Name';

```

这条语句会返回两个结果:完整的主机地址以及附加在其后的非默认实例标签部分。如果SQL Server是默认实例,则`InstanceName`列将返回空值。

方法四:使用SQL Server Management Studio

SQL Server Management Studio(SSMS)是一个功能强大的集成环境,用于管理和查询SQL Server。通过SSMS,你可以轻松查看当前连接的SQL Server实例名称。

1. 打开SQL Server Management Studio:在Windows开始菜单中找到并打开SQL Server Management Studio。

2. 连接到服务器:在“连接到服务器”对话框中,选择服务器类型为“数据库引擎”,然后输入服务器名称和登录凭据。单击“连接”按钮以连接到SQL Server实例。

3. 查看实例名称:一旦成功连接到实例,你将在SSMS左上角的标题栏中看到实例的名称。另外,你也可以通过执行以下T-SQL语句来查看实例名称:

```sql

SELECT SERVERPROPERTY('InstanceName') AS 'Instance Name';

```

SSMS提供了直观的用户界面,使得查看和管理SQL Server实例变得非常便捷。

方法五:通过Windows服务管理器

Windows服务管理器(Services Console,services.msc)是另一个可以查看SQL Server实例名的工具。

1. 打开服务管理器:按下Win + R组合键,输入“services.msc”并按下回车键,打开服务管理器。

2. 找到SQL Server服务:在服务列表中,找到以“SQL Server”开头的服务项。这些服务项的名称中通常包含了实例名称。例如,“SQL Server (MSSQLSERVER)”表示默认实例,而“SQL Server (INSTANCE_NAME)”则表示命名实例。

通过服务管理器查看实例名是一种简单直观的方法,尤其适用于对系统服务有一定了解的用户。

方法六:使用PowerShell

PowerShell是一个强大的任务自动化和配置管理框架,也可以用于管理SQL Server。通过PowerShell,你可以连接到SQL Server实例并获取其名称。

1. 打开PowerShell控制台:在Windows开始菜单中找到并打开PowerShell控制台。

2. 运行PowerShell命令:在PowerShell控制台中,输入以下命令并按下回车键:

```powershell

$serverInstance = New-Object Microsoft.SqlServer.Management.Smo.Server("localhost")

$serverInstance.InstanceName

```

这条命令使用了SQL Server Management Objects(SMO)库来连接到SQL Server实例,并输出实例名称。请注意,使用此方法需要确保已安装SQL Server PowerShell模块。

注意事项

在查看和操作SQL Server实例名称时,请确保你拥有足够的权限。

直接编辑注册表有一定的风险,如果不熟悉注册表结构,请谨慎操作。

某些方法可能因SQL Server版本的不同而有所差异,请根据实际情况进行相应调整。

综上所述,查看SQL Server实例名有多种方法可供选择。无论你是通过SQL Server Configuration Manager、Windows注册表、T-SQL查询语句、SQL Server Management Studio、Windows服务管理器还是PowerShell,都可以轻松找到已安装的SQL Server实例的名称。选择适合你需求和环境的方法,让你的数据库管理工作更加高效便捷。

最新游戏
  • 火力掩护内置菜单版类型:飞行射击
    大小:397.41M

    火力掩护内置菜单版是一款集动作、策略与射击于一体的手机游戏。...

  • 解忧暖心喵app类型:社交通讯
    大小:71.79M

    解忧暖心喵app简介 解忧暖心喵app是一款专注于青少...

  • 豚豚追剧手机版类型:影音娱乐
    大小:17.56M

    豚豚追剧手机版是一款专为影视爱好者设计的追剧神器,集高清播放...

  • 维词app高中学生版类型:学习办公
    大小:21.34M

    维词app高中学生版是一款专为高中学生设计的英语词汇学习应用...

  • meetu觅兔游戏类型:冒险解谜
    大小:64.24M

    Meetu觅兔是一款充满趣味与挑战的冒险解谜类手机游戏。玩家...

本站所有软件来自互联网,版权归原著所有。如有侵权,敬请来信告知 ,我们将及时删除。 琼ICP备2023003481号-5